Key Responsibilities of a Superintendent | Healthcare Construction | Houston

  • Project Oversight: Manage day-to-day operations on the construction site, ensuring the project stays on schedule and within budget.
  • Team Coordination: Supervise subcontractors, field staff, and vendors to ensure work is performed safely and to quality standards.
  • Scheduling & Planning: Develop and maintain construction schedules, coordinate material deliveries, and anticipate potential delays or issues.
  • Quality Control: Enforce construction standards, conduct inspections, and ensure compliance with plans, specifications, and codes.
  • Safety Management: Implement and monitor safety protocols to maintain a safe work environment and ensure OSHA compliance.
  • Communication: Serve as the primary liaison between field operations and project managers, clients, and inspectors.
  • Problem Solving: Address and resolve issues that arise on-site, including conflicts, delays, and unforeseen conditions.
  • Documentation: Maintain accurate daily reports, logs, and records of site activities, inspections, and progress.
